Sober in the Country:

If you're new to the work of bush charity Sober in the Country, it's essential to understand they don't preach a message of prohibition, and never have. Their work lies in showing bush communities that when we are all part of being socially inclusive - and catering carefully and thoughtfully (beyond just booze or cheap sugary drinks) for all our mates, lives are changed and saved.

So whether you're a drinker, a non-drinker, or somewhere in the middle, there's something for absolutely everybody to take away from their decade of boots-on-the-ground advocacy and learnings.
